Teen Menstruation: Irregular Periods
For the first two years after girls start their periods, it is very common for them to be irregular. But after a few years of regular periods, you should be concerned if they suddenly become irregular. In that case, I recommend your daughter be evaluated by a physician.
While pregnancy is the most common reason women stop having periods, there are other reasons as well. Thyroid disease, polycystic ovarian syndrome, rigorous regular exercise and eating disorders are a few of the other possible causes. A gynecologist can sort out these issues for you.
